Khakharathal Population - Surendranagar, Gujarat

Khakharathal is a large village located in Muli Taluka of Surendranagar district, Gujarat with total 416 families residing. The Khakharathal village has population of 2427 of which 1236 are males while 1191 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Khakharathal village population of children with age 0-6 is 490 which makes up 20.19 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Khakharathal village is 964 which is higher than Gujarat state average of 919. Child Sex Ratio for the Khakharathal as per census is 1103, higher than Gujarat average of 890.

Khakharathal village has lower literacy rate compared to Gujarat. In 2011, literacy rate of Khakharathal village was 56.43 % compared to 78.03 % of Gujarat. In Khakharathal Male literacy stands at 68.00 % while female literacy rate was 44.00 %.

Khakharathal Data

Particulars Total Male Female
Total No. of Houses 416 - -
Population 2,427 1,236 1,191
Child (0-6) 490 233 257
Schedule Caste 271 141 130
Schedule Tribe 0 0 0
Literacy 56.43 % 68.00 % 44.00 %
Total Workers 1,071 654 417
Main Worker 587 - -
Marginal Worker 484 99 385

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 11.17 % of total population in Khakharathal village. The village Khakharathal curr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Khakharathal village out of total population, 1071 were engaged in work activities. 54.81 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 45.19 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1071 workers engaged in Main Work, 336 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 156 were Agricultural labourer.
